Skip to content

Commit

Permalink
Improve vtorc recovery logs
Browse files Browse the repository at this point in the history
* Improved PrefixedLogger consistency between formatted & unformatted logs.
* Use PrefixedLogger in more places during vtorc recoveries.

Signed-off-by: Eduardo J. Ortega U. <5791035+ejortegau@users.noreply.github.com>
  • Loading branch information
ejortegau committed Jan 17, 2025
1 parent 2c5c25d commit ee34454
Show file tree
Hide file tree
Showing 3 changed files with 66 additions and 45 deletions.
12 changes: 6 additions & 6 deletions go/vt/log/log.go
Original file line number Diff line number Diff line change
Expand Up @@ -117,7 +117,7 @@ type PrefixedLogger struct {
}

func NewPrefixedLogger(prefix string) *PrefixedLogger {
return &PrefixedLogger{prefix: prefix}
return &PrefixedLogger{prefix: prefix + ": "}
}

func (pl *PrefixedLogger) V(level glog.Level) glog.Verbose {
Expand All @@ -135,7 +135,7 @@ func (pl *PrefixedLogger) Info(args ...any) {

func (pl *PrefixedLogger) Infof(format string, args ...any) {
args = append([]interface{}{pl.prefix}, args...)
Infof("%s: "+format, args...)
Infof("%s"+format, args...)
}

func (pl *PrefixedLogger) InfoDepth(depth int, args ...any) {
Expand All @@ -150,7 +150,7 @@ func (pl *PrefixedLogger) Warning(args ...any) {

func (pl *PrefixedLogger) Warningf(format string, args ...any) {
args = append([]interface{}{pl.prefix}, args...)
Warningf("%s: "+format, args...)
Warningf("%s"+format, args...)
}

func (pl *PrefixedLogger) WarningDepth(depth int, args ...any) {
Expand All @@ -165,7 +165,7 @@ func (pl *PrefixedLogger) Error(args ...any) {

func (pl *PrefixedLogger) Errorf(format string, args ...any) {
args = append([]interface{}{pl.prefix}, args...)
Errorf("%s: "+format, args...)
Errorf("%s"+format, args...)
}

func (pl *PrefixedLogger) ErrorDepth(depth int, args ...any) {
Expand All @@ -180,7 +180,7 @@ func (pl *PrefixedLogger) Exit(args ...any) {

func (pl *PrefixedLogger) Exitf(format string, args ...any) {
args = append([]interface{}{pl.prefix}, args...)
Exitf("%s: "+format, args...)
Exitf("%s"+format, args...)
}

func (pl *PrefixedLogger) ExitDepth(depth int, args ...any) {
Expand All @@ -195,7 +195,7 @@ func (pl *PrefixedLogger) Fatal(args ...any) {

func (pl *PrefixedLogger) Fatalf(format string, args ...any) {
args = append([]interface{}{pl.prefix}, args...)
Fatalf("%s: "+format, args...)
Fatalf("%s"+format, args...)
}

func (pl *PrefixedLogger) FatalDepth(depth int, args ...any) {
Expand Down
Loading

0 comments on commit ee34454

Please sign in to comment.